分析
我有一个适用于安卓手机的应用程序,用于收集牲畜GPS 位置数据并将其传输到服务器……目前我每 10 分钟传输一次位置。由于在连接之间切换到飞行模式,电池寿命为 1 天。
为了延长电池寿命,我将 GPRS 连接之间的时间延长到可以接受的数据延迟(GPRS 覆盖率低、缺乏和动物移动使其变得困难)。
用户需要15天的电池寿命,我想用软件来达到。
问题
为了以编程方式收集电池使用情况,我已经阅读了有关电池电量的信息,但是有人知道如何精确监控GPS和GPRS 调制解调器的功耗吗?
至少,有人知道如何以编程方式获取“设置”>“设备”>“电池使用信息”吗?